Abstract
This report takes a competitive look at the primary telcos and third party providers serving the healthcare industry. A number of the top telecom providers and systems integrators are profiled in this study. This is directly beneficial for those interested in what the competition is doing in the healthcare space, especially those searching to grow their healthcare vertical programs.
 
 Vendors targeting the healthcare industry are growing in numbers, primarily due to the healthcare’s growing adoption of high-tech solutions, especially those that are wireless-, HIPAA-, or patient automation-related. The small and medium healthcare segment is the fastest growing opportunity for vendors, yet the enterprise healthcare organizations appear to be faster adopters of technologies such as WLAN (Wireless Local Area Network), IP (Internet Protocol), and healthcare specific applications.
